WebOptimize lifestyle measures, and drug treatments for secondary prevention. Management of a suspected TIA in primary care includes: Giving aspirin 300 mg immediately (unless contraindicated or taking aspirin regularly) and arranging specialist assessment within 24 hours if a suspected TIA has occurred within the last week.
